Vintage Anthropomorphic Orange Pears Kissing Salt and Pepper Shakers, Japan
Physical Description: These charming salt and pepper shakers are crafted from ceramic and feature a whimsical design resembling two anthropomorphic orange pears with green leaves. The dimensions are approximately 2 1/4" in height, 1 3/4" in length, and 3" in width, weighing about 4 ounces. The bright orange color and intricate facial details add to their playful appeal.
Condition Assessment: The shakers are in fair condition, showing signs of wear consistent with age. There is some residual scotch tape on the bottoms, and the cork stoppers are missing. However, the paint and ceramic structure remain intact, with no major chips or cracks.
Historical Context: These shakers were brought back from Japan during the post-World War II occupation by the owner's uncle, who served in the Navy. They were originally owned by the owner’s grandmother, who kept them in a curio cabinet until 1994. This historical connection adds a layer of significance to the item.
Collector Appeal: Collectors value anthropomorphic salt and pepper shakers for their unique designs and nostalgic charm. This category often reflects the playful design trends of the mid-20th century, making them a popular choice for collectors of kitchenware and Americana.
Interesting Facts: The shakers' design mimics the appearance of pumpkins, making them particularly appealing for seasonal decor during harvest festivals and Halloween. Their playful expressions add a delightful touch to any dining setting.
Valuation: Based on condition, historical significance, and comparable sales, the estimated value range for these shakers is $20 to $40.
